Output 8786c5bb78ac84f7a08aaab9ed966eb05e894ee74958e85207832399f219f4d8:141

value
104433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37499e30f72d60eee06e8ad9cd5e19025397b530 OP_EQUAL
address
36jMHA8SLSxgqvNDsNuu4ohKxqXYKpUpg2
transaction
8786c5bb78ac84f7a08aaab9ed966eb05e894ee74958e85207832399f219f4d8
confirmations
152336
spent
true